How the Critical Process Failure Actually Works
Windows 11 runs on a complex kernel architecture where essential processes manage memory, input/output, and hardware communication. A “Critical Process” failure occurs when a vital system component crashes unexpectedly—often under heavy load or due to corruption during startup or updates. Though Windows includes safeguards, rare conflicts between drivers, background applications, or corrupted system files can trigger abrupt termination. The “5; You Lost Everything” reference likely stems from user reports of sudden app unresponsiveness, file system freezes, and data access blocks occurring during these moments—symbolizing perceived total system disruption.
Technically, these events are caught by built-in error reporting tools like the Windows Event Viewer, yet interpretation requires awareness. Most failures resolve autonomously through restart or automatic recovery scripts, though repeated incidents indicate deeper systemic strain needing targeted fixes.

Common Questions People Are Asking
Q: How do I know if my system hit a critical process failure?
Signs include random crashes, blue screens (BSOD), frozen apps, slow boot times, and inaccessible files. No immediate blue screen—silence often hides stress. Use Task Manager, Event Viewer (via Run > eventvwr), and system files check tools to detect process errors.
Q: Is my data safe during this kind of crash?
Generally yes. Windows preserves data unless corruption affects file access directly. Run disk checks with chkdsk, scan for malware, and confirm backups via OneDrive or local solutions—proactive measures prevent permanent loss.
